Purim and a candy buzz

My favorite holiday secular or religious is Purim. It's so much fun. Everyone dresses up, there's carnivals, and lots of food and drink. One tradition is to exchange Purim baskets (mashloach manot). Some folks go all out and make very fancy and clever baskets. 

We stepped it up a bit this year with a theme (purple), cute note (printed in purple ink), (purple) Easter stuffing, and plentiful candy (purple).

So many awesome themed bags: Frozen, Candyland, 7-Eleven, and many more.
